Subject: Ownership change — Queuemill autoscaler

Effective next Monday, responsibility for the Queuemill queue-depth autoscaler transfers out of the Platform Reliability group at Ferncliff Systems. Scaling policy changes, threshold overrides, and emergency manual scaling actions will all route through the new owner, who also assumes review duty for related access requests. For the security review record, the incoming responsible party is stated below.

account owner for bawip-tahag: Raleth Quenok

Handover: FlintBridge websocket reconnect bug

Passing this to whoever picks up support duty. Symptom: FlintBridge clients occasionally reconnect in a tight loop after a gateway restart, hammering the auth service. Root cause appears to be a missing jitter on the reconnect backoff — the fix is merged but only deployed to staging so far. If customers report connection storms before the prod rollout, you can mitigate by raising the backoff ceiling at runtime. The relevant settings, with their current staging values, are below.

settings of fafog-haduf:
ZORIX_PIN=4648
ZORIX_METRICS_HOST=metrics.zorix.paliqsys.corp
ZORIX_LOG_LEVEL=info
ZORIX_TENANT=druix

Escalation: When Tidewell Calendar and the Plover sync bridge disagree on event ownership, you'll see duplicate invites piling up fast. First, pause the bridge worker — don't just restart it, that makes things worse. Check which side last wrote the event and mark it canonical in the sync console. If dupes keep spawning after two pause/resume cycles, or a customer launch is affected, don't sit on it. Ping the sync platform crew at the address below.

escalation mailbox, bafog-fafog: ulador@paliqlabs.internal

### Step 4: Enable bulk edits in the Coppertray admin table

Heads up — once you flip bulk edits on, the admin table switches to the new selection model, and there's no toggling back mid-release. Make sure the batch queue is drained first, or queued single edits will get orphaned. After the drain, apply the settings below to every region.

deployment values, fahap-hahaf:
[casdor]
port = 9200
region = south-2
host = casdor.qirvanworks.corp
timeout_ms = 3000
retries = 4